Setting of minimum operating currents
The operation of the distance function will be blocked if the magnitude of the currents
is below the set value of the parameter IMinOpPE.
The default setting of IMinOpPE is 20% of IBase where IBase is the chosen base
current for the analogue input channels. The value have been proven in practice to be
suitable in most of the applications. However, there might be applications where it is
necessary to increase the sensitivity by reducing the minimum operating current down
to 10% of the IED base current. This happens especially in cases, when the IED serves
as a remote back-up protection on series of very long transmission lines.
If the load current compensation is activated, there is an additional criteria IMinOpIN
that will block the phase-ground loop if the 3I0<IMinOpIN. The default setting of
IMinOpIN is 5% of the IED base current IBase.
The minimum operating fault current is automatically reduced to 75% of its set value,
if the distance protection zone has been set for the operation in reverse direction.
